Lines Matching refs:path
36 ME = os.path.basename(sys.argv[0])
374 self.art_dir = os.path.join(top_dir, "art")
376 self.art_test_dir = os.path.join(self.art_dir, "test")
378 self.mts_config_dir = os.path.join(
388 run_test_path = os.path.join(self.art_test_dir, run_test)
389 metadata_file = os.path.join(run_test_path, "test-metadata.json")
391 if os.path.exists(metadata_file):
422 run_test_path = os.path.join(self.art_test_dir, run_test)
426 if (os.path.isfile(os.path.join(run_test_path, "generate-sources")) or
427 os.path.isfile(os.path.join(run_test_path, "javac_post.sh"))):
429 if os.path.isfile(os.path.join(run_test_path, "build.py")):
443 if os.path.isdir(os.path.join(run_test_path, subdir)):
446 if os.path.isdir(os.path.join(run_test_path, "src")) and \
447 os.path.isdir(os.path.join(run_test_path, "src-art")):
450 if not os.path.isdir(os.path.join(run_test_path, "src")) and \
451 not os.path.isdir(os.path.join(run_test_path, "src-art")):
454 if os.path.isfile(os.path.join(run_test_path, "src", "sun", "misc", "Unsafe.java")):
457 if os.path.isfile(os.path.join(run_test_path, "hiddenapi-flags.csv")):
509 run_test_path = os.path.join(self.art_test_dir, run_test)
513 if os.path.isfile(os.path.join(run_test_path, "run.py")):
528 bp_file = os.path.join(self.art_test_dir, run_test, "Android.bp")
529 if os.path.exists(bp_file):
539 run_test_path = os.path.join(self.art_test_dir, run_test)
540 bp_file = os.path.join(run_test_path, "Android.bp")
591 if os.path.isdir(os.path.join(run_test_path, "src-art")):
598 if os.path.isdir(os.path.join(run_test_path, "src2")):
635 in_file = os.path.join(run_test_path, f"expected-{type_str}.txt")
636 if os.path.islink(in_file):
641 basename = os.path.basename(in_file)
762 test_mapping_file = os.path.join(self.art_dir, "TEST_MAPPING")
824 test_plan_file = os.path.join(self.mts_config_dir, self.test_plan_name() + ".xml")
891 test_list_file = os.path.join(self.mts_config_dir, self.test_list_name() + ".xml")
937 mts_art_tests_list_user_file = os.path.join(self.mts_config_dir, "mts-art-tests-list-user.xml")
952 shard_path = os.path.join(self.mts_config_dir, shard)
953 if os.path.exists(shard_path):
1119 generator = Generator(os.path.join(os.environ["ANDROID_BUILD_TOP"]))